Overview: Train from Oxford to Stafford
Trains from Oxford to Stafford run on average 6 times per day, taking around 1h 53m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$40 (€32) if you book in advance.
There are 5 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 05:20, the last at 21:39. The fastest train covers the 81 miles (131 km) distance in 1h 50m.
